Step 1: Sericulture – Raising Silkworms & Harvesting Cocoons for Silk Threads

Raising silkworms on mulberry leaves, a crucial step in traditional silk production.

The genesis of silk lies with the remarkable silkworm, the larval stage of the Bombyx mori moth. This foundational step, known as sericulture, is an art form in itself, requiring diligent care and a deep understanding of the silkworm’s lifecycle. A female silkmoth typically lays between 300 to 500 tiny eggs. These precious eggs are carefully incubated under controlled conditions of temperature and humidity until they hatch, revealing minuscule caterpillars.

Once hatched, these delicate creatures embark on a voracious feeding frenzy, exclusively consuming fresh, tender mulberry leaves. The quality and abundance of mulberry leaves are paramount, as they directly influence the health of the silkworms and the quality of the silk they produce. For approximately six weeks, the caterpillars grow rapidly, molting several times as they fatten up, storing energy for their final, incredible act.

When they reach maturity, the silkworms stop eating and begin their astonishing transformation. They secrete a liquid protein through two glands in their heads, which solidifies upon contact with air to form a continuous, incredibly fine filament. This filament is meticulously spun around their bodies in a figure-eight motion, creating a protective cocoon. Each cocoon is a marvel, typically fashioned from a single, unbroken strand of silk that can measure an astonishing 300 to 900 meters (or even up to 1500 meters in some cases). This delicate filament is held together by sericin, a natural gum that coats the silk fiber and provides rigidity to the cocoon structure. The process of spinning a cocoon can take a silkworm anywhere from three to eight days, showcasing nature’s efficiency and precision.

Once the cocoons are fully formed, they are carefully harvested. Timing is crucial; the pupa inside must not be allowed to mature into moths and break out of the cocoons, as this would sever the continuous silk filament, making it unusable for fine silk thread. Step 2: Degumming & Reeling – Extracting the Silk Threads

Traditional silk thread extraction using boiling water and a reeling device.

After the laborious process of sericulture, the next critical step is to extract the precious silk threads from the harvested cocoons. This stage, known as degumming and reeling, is where the raw, protective cocoons are transformed into usable silk filaments, ready for weaving. The primary challenge here is to separate the continuous silk thread from the sericin gum that binds it and to prevent the pupa inside from emerging and breaking the thread.

To achieve this, the cocoons are carefully placed into boiling water. This controlled heating serves a dual purpose: it gently softens the sericin, allowing the silk filament to unravel smoothly, and it humanely kills the silkworm pupa inside, preserving the integrity of the long, continuous strand. The timing and temperature of this boiling process are crucial, requiring skilled hands to ensure the sericin is adequately softened without damaging the delicate silk fibers themselves.

Once the sericin is sufficiently pliable, the reeling process begins. Artisans use brushes or their fingers to find the outer end of the silk filament on each cocoon. Several filaments (typically between 5 to 20, depending on the desired thickness of the final yarn) are then gathered together and twisted as they are carefully unwound and wound onto a reeling device, often a large wheel or a specialized machine. This twisting combines the individual, impossibly fine filaments into a single, stronger, and more manageable thread. The skill of the reeler is paramount here, ensuring that the threads are consistent in thickness and free from tangles.

This combined filament, still coated with some residual sericin, is known as raw silk. After the initial reeling, the threads undergo further cleaning to remove any remaining natural gum. They are often bleached to achieve a uniform light color, which is essential for dyeing, or left in their natural creamy white state. Finally, the silk threads are thoroughly dried, leaving behind lustrous, strong, and incredibly smooth fibers that are now ready for the next stages of transformation into luxurious textiles. Step 3: Dyeing – Infusing Silk with Nature’s Hues

A person dipping naturally dyed silk threads into a silver pot in an outdoor setting.

With the pristine silk threads meticulously extracted and cleaned, the next captivating step in the traditional silk-making process is dyeing. This stage breathes vibrant life into the fibers, transforming them from their natural creamy white into a spectrum of mesmerizing colors. In traditional Thai villages, like the one Designboom highlighted, the art of dyeing is deeply rooted in nature, employing ancient techniques and locally sourced botanical ingredients to create a unique palette.

Unlike modern synthetic dyes, traditional silk dyeing relies on natural pigments derived from a vast array of plants, fruits, bark, roots, and leaves. For instance, rich reds might come from lac insects or sappanwood, deep blues from indigo, vibrant yellows from mango leaves or turmeric, and earthy browns from various barks or nuts. Each source imparts a distinct hue, often yielding softer, more nuanced, and organically varied tones that are characteristic of natural dyeing.

The process involves immersing the silk threads into large pots of hot water infused with these natural dyestuffs. The threads are carefully agitated to ensure even color absorption. To help the natural dyes bind permanently to the silk fibers, mordants – natural substances like alum, iron, or ash – are often used. These mordants act as a bridge between the dye and the fiber, improving colorfastness and intensity.

Achieving the desired depth and quality of color is a patient and repetitive endeavor. Artisans will often soak and dry the silk multiple times over several days, or even weeks, repeating the dyeing process until the perfect shade is attained. The exact color can also vary subtly depending on factors such as the maturity of the plant material, the time of harvest, the water quality, and even the weather conditions during dyeing. This variability ensures that each batch of naturally dyed silk possesses a unique character and charm, making every piece truly one-of-a-kind. Step 4: Spinning – Preparing the Threads for Weaving

Artisan spinning naturally dyed silk threads on a traditional spinning wheel.

Once the silk threads have been meticulously extracted, degummed, and beautifully dyed with natural pigments, they are still relatively delicate. The next crucial step in the traditional silk-making process is spinning, which prepares these individual filaments for the rigorous demands of weaving. This stage is essential for imparting strength, consistency, and the desired texture to the final yarn.

Spinning involves twisting multiple silk filaments together to form a single, cohesive, and stronger strand of yarn. While the initial reeling process in Step 2 already combines several fine filaments, this subsequent spinning step further refines and strengthens the thread. In traditional settings, this is often done by hand using a spinning wheel or a simpler spindle. The artisan carefully guides the silk fibers, applying just the right amount of tension and twist to create a uniform yarn.

The degree of twist imparted during spinning is critical. A tighter twist results in a stronger, more resilient yarn, which is often preferred for the warp threads (the longitudinal threads on a loom that bear significant tension). A looser twist might be used for the weft threads (the transverse threads woven through the warp), allowing for a softer hand and greater drape in the finished fabric. Different spinning techniques can also produce yarns with varied textures, from smooth and lustrous to slightly slubby and rustic, each contributing to the unique character of the woven silk.

This seemingly simple act of twisting requires immense skill and consistency. An experienced spinner can maintain an even thickness and tension throughout a long strand of silk, ensuring that the finished fabric will have a uniform appearance and durability. The spun silk threads are then carefully wound onto bobbins or skeins, meticulously prepared to become either the warp or weft threads for the upcoming weaving stage, or in some cases, to undergo another intricate dyeing process like Ikat, which we will explore next.

Step 5: Ikat – The Art of Patterned Dyeing Before Weaving

Intricate Ikat dyeing process, where bound yarns create complex patterns.

For designers and artisans aiming to create silk fabrics adorned with complex and breathtaking patterns, Ikat (pronounced “ee-kat”) is an indispensable and highly specialized step. Originating from the Malay-Indonesian word for “to bind” or “to tie,” Ikat is a traditional form of resist dyeing applied to the yarns *before* they are woven into fabric. This ancient technique is revered globally for its intricate beauty and the characteristic “blurred” or feathered edges of its designs, which are a hallmark of its handmade nature.

The process of Ikat is incredibly labor-intensive and demands meticulous planning and precision. First, the design for the final fabric is carefully envisioned and mapped out. Then, individual silk yarns, or sometimes groups of yarns, are precisely bound with a resist material – typically tightly wrapped threads, rubber, or plastic – according to the planned pattern. These bindings prevent the dye from penetrating specific areas of the yarn, thereby creating the pattern.

Once bound, the yarns are then submerged into dye baths, similar to the general dyeing process in Step 3. After dyeing, the bindings are removed, revealing the dyed and undyed sections of the yarn. For multi-colored Ikat patterns, this binding and dyeing process is repeated multiple times. New bindings are applied to resist a different color, and previous bindings might be removed or adjusted, before the yarn is dyed again in a new hue. This sequential dyeing, with each color applied over a previously bound section, builds up layers of intricate patterns.

The complexity of the pattern directly correlates with the number of bindings and dye baths required, often demanding weeks or even months of work for a single textile. There are various types of Ikat, including warp Ikat (where only the warp threads are dyed), weft Ikat (where only the weft threads are dyed), and double Ikat (where both warp and weft threads are dyed and aligned to form the pattern, representing the pinnacle of Ikat artistry). The slight misalignment of the dyed threads during weaving gives Ikat its distinctive, softly blurred appearance, adding to its unique charm and indicating its handcrafted origin. Step 6: Weaving – Bringing the Fabric to Life

Skilled artisan weaving silk fabric on a traditional loom in Thailand.

The final and perhaps most transformative stage in the traditional silk-making process is weaving. After the silk threads have been meticulously cultivated, extracted, dyed (and possibly Ikat-patterned), they converge at the loom, where skilled weavers painstakingly interlace them to create the finished silk fabric. This stage is where all the previous efforts culminate, and the raw threads are finally brought to life as a tangible, luxurious textile.

In traditional Thai villages, weaving is often performed on manual looms, such as backstrap looms or traditional frame looms, which have been used for generations. The process begins by preparing the warp threads – the longitudinal threads that are stretched tautly on the loom. These threads must be strong and evenly tensioned. The weft threads – the transverse threads that are passed over and under the warp – are then carefully inserted, one by one, using a shuttle.

The weaver manipulates various heddles to lift and lower specific groups of warp threads, creating an opening (shed) through which the shuttle carrying the weft thread is passed. By alternating the pattern of lifted warp threads, different weaving styles and textures can be achieved. Common weaves include plain weave (a simple over-and-under pattern), twill (diagonal ribs), and satin weave (which creates the characteristic smooth, lustrous surface of silk by having most of the warp or weft threads floating on the surface).

For more intricate designs, particularly in Thai silk, supplementary weft techniques are often employed. Here, additional colored threads are introduced as extra wefts to create raised patterns and motifs, adding depth and richness to the fabric. If the silk threads underwent the Ikat process (Step 5), the weaver must possess exceptional skill to precisely align the dyed patterns in the warp and weft threads, ensuring the complex design emerges correctly on the fabric.
